Yesterday was the 50th anniversary of the 1958 Southeast Alaska earthquake and ensuing Lituya Bay megatsunami, a half-kilometer high wave which killed only a handful of people.

i-1d17aafb1b00ad29edb0262d84f99a3e-gilbert-landslide-scar.jpg The earthquake happened on the Fairweather fault, a strike-slip fault which forms the main boundary between the Pacific and North American plates on the Alaska panhandle. Strike-slip earthquakes don't typically cause tsunamis directly - in a strike-slip event, the ground moves mostly horizontally, not vertically, so it doesn't displace any water to speak of. This tsunami was caused by a large chunk of mountain that fell into the ocean as a result of the earthquake.

i-dbab36ea9d57035119838b284d03dbb0-lituya-damage.jpg The same structure which generates strong tidal currents within Lituya Bay also funneled the tsunami into a super-high wave. There's not much in this photo for scale, but wave damage was found at altitudes of up to 1,720 feet (524m).
